[Platelet activating factor in biological fluids of animals with different species-specific resistance at the stage of infective process after inoculation with mycobacterium tuberculosis].

Abstract

Following 24 hours, 1, 2, and 6 weeks of inoculation of guinea-pigs and albino rats by Mycobacterium tuberculosis (MT), the levels of platelet activation factor (PAF) were determined in the plasma, leukocytes, alveolar macrophages, nonfractionated cellular sediment and fluid of bronchoalveolar lavage (FBAL) by testing rabbit platelets. The guinea-pigs developed generalized tuberculosis, the rats receiving a small dose of MT developed nonspecific inflammation and those taking a large dose had specific foci. In both experiments, spontaneous regression of inflammatory changes began in rats after 6 weeks. In the guinea-pigs inoculated by MT, there was a steady increase in PAF synthesis in all cell populations, PAF levels dropped in fluids. In the rats receiving a small dose of MT, the cellular levels PAF levels periodically rose in early infection, but decreased below the control values during regression of inflammatory changes. Concurrently, the level of PAF became lower in plasma and FBAL. With high-dose inoculation, it drastically fell in the cells just after MT administration, then moderately increased during the development of specific changes and again dropped at the end of the experiment. In early infection the changes in PAF levels in the body's fluids were mirror as regards to the respective cells, but at regression of specific changes, the content of PAF was lower than the normal values in all the fluids under study.
